How to Create an Interactive Map: A Step-by-Step Guide
Interactive maps are excellent tools for presenting geographical information in an engaging and informative way. These maps are not only helpful for understanding navigation, but they also enable users to delve deeper into the communities and landscapes they are interested in. Interactive maps are widely used in various fields including travel, geography, marketing, and education. If you are looking to create an interactive map, you have come to the right place.
Making an interactive map may seem like an arduous task, but with the right approach, it’s easy to accomplish. The process consists of several steps, starting from selecting a mapping tool to adding your data and designing the map’s interface. Our guide will take you through everything you need to know to make an interactive map that is tailored to your needs and requirements. So, grab your pens and notepads, put on your thinking cap, and let’s get started.
.
Choosing a Map Building Platform
When it comes to making an interactive map there are a multitude of options available. Each platform offers unique features, pricing structures and target audiences. Finding the right platform that suits your needs is crucial for creating an effective interactive map. Let’s take a look at some of the most popular ones available today.
Google Maps
Google Maps is arguably the most popular and widely-used map building platform. Not only does it offer a wide range of functionality, like search and directions, but it integrates seamlessly with other Google products. Google Maps offers various pricing tiers starting from free up to $10,000 per month for enterprise-level use. It’s a great option for businesses and individuals alike.
Leaflet
If you’re looking for an open-source platform, Leaflet is a great option. It’s a lightweight platform that’s easy to use and features interactive and mobile-friendly maps. Leaflet is free to use and also offers a wide range of plugins and templates that can be used for customization. This platform is perfect for developers, small businesses and individuals.
Mapbox
Mapbox is a popular choice for creating custom maps that feature unique styles and data layers. It offers a wide range of customization options and provides high-quality map hosting services. Mapbox relies on open-source technology and is a good choice for developers, data scientists and journalists. Mapbox pricing starts at $5 per month for personal use and goes up to custom enterprise pricing.
OpenStreetMap
OpenStreetMap offers a free and open-source map building platform that relies on user-generated content. It’s powered by a community of mappers who are constantly updating and improving the maps. This platform is perfect for developers, journalists and activists who want to create maps to support their cause. OpenStreetMap offers a range of tools and plugins and is completely free to use.
ArcGIS
ArcGIS is an enterprise-level map building platform that’s used by government organizations, Fortune 500 companies and other large entities. It offers a wide range of features, data layers and tools that can be used for creating complex maps. However, this level of customization comes at a high price point. ArcGIS pricing starts at $1,500 per year and can go up to $100,000 or more depending on the level of use.
MapTiler
MapTiler offers an easy-to-use platform that allows users to create their own maps from geodata files. Its features include map hosting, vector and raster tile rendering, and geocoding. MapTiler is great if you want to build a web map that matches your branding and offers your desired features. MapTiler is free to use but requires a professional plan for commercial usage.
Bing Maps
Bing Maps is a map building platform offered by Microsoft. It’s a cheaper alternative to Google Maps and has similar functionality. Bing Maps is suitable for developers and businesses that want to use maps to enhance their websites and applications. Bing Maps is free for basic use and a paid development account is required for commercial use.
CARTO
CARTO is a mapping platform that allows users to create maps based on their data without the need of programming or GIS experience. It’s a cloud-based platform that offers a range of features like data visualization, analysis, and geospatial functions. CARTO also offers a free trial of the software in multiple package tiers – BUILDER (starts from $149/month) and ENGINE (starts from $499/month) for businesses and access to multiple Enterprise level features that requires custom pricing.
Mapline
Mapline is a simple mapping platform that lets users create interactive maps that visualize their data. It offers a range of tools and features that are designed to help businesses make data-driven decisions. Mapline offers a free basic plan, with additional features offered at different price points depending on the needs of the user.
Esri ArcGIS Online
Esri’s ArcGIS Online is a cloud-based mapping platform that enables users to create interactive maps using data from various sources, including Open Data and Living Atlas. It offers a range of features including analysis, data hosting and sharing, and integration with other Esri technologies. The pricing starts at $5,000/year for desktop use and goes up based on the number of users and required features.
Whether you are a small business owner, a developer, or just someone who wants to create a cool map, there is a platform out there for you. Consider your needs and budget to find the best platform that suits you best. In the next section, we’ll dive into how to create your map once you’ve chosen a platform.
Section Two: Creating an Interactive Map
Interactive maps are a great way to display your data in an engaging, user-friendly way. In this section, we will guide you through the process of creating an interactive map from start to finish. Here are ten steps to creating your very own interactive map:
Step 1: Choose Your Data Source
The first step in creating an interactive map is to decide where your data will come from. This may involve collecting data yourself, such as through surveys or environmental monitoring, or using publicly available data from sources like government agencies or academic research. Make sure that your data is relevant to your audience and is presented in a format that is easy to understand.
Step 2: Choose Your Map Platform
Once you have your data, you need to choose a mapping platform to display it on. There are many options available, ranging from free tools like Google Maps to more complex options like Mapbox. Consider your budget, technical skills, and desired level of customization when making your choice.
Step 3: Import Your Data
Most map platforms allow you to import data in a variety of formats, such as CSV, KML, or GeoJSON. Make sure that your data is properly formatted and that any location data is accurate before importing it into your chosen platform.
Step 4: Choose Your Map Design
The design of your map can greatly impact its user-friendliness and aesthetic appeal. Consider factors such as color scheme, fonts, and the placement of labels and symbols. You may also want to add additional layers and markers to enhance the user experience.
Step 5: Customize Your Map Interactivity
One of the key benefits of interactive maps is their ability to allow users to interact with the data in real-time. Consider adding features like hover-over tooltips, clickable markers, and searchable databases to make your map engaging and easy to use.
Step 6: Add Map Controls
Map controls, such as zoom and pan functions, allow users to navigate and explore your map easily. Make sure that your map controls are well-placed and intuitive to use.
Step 7: Test Your Map
Before publishing your map, make sure to thoroughly test it to spot any bugs or usability issues. Solicit feedback from colleagues or beta testers to make improvements and ensure that your map is working properly.
Step 8: Publish Your Map
Once you have finished designing and testing your map, it’s time to publish it. Be sure to choose a hosting platform that can handle the traffic and data requirements of your map and adjust your security and privacy settings as needed.
Step 9: Promote Your Map
To get the most out of your interactive map, it’s important to promote it effectively. Consider using social media, email marketing, or other targeted outreach to get the word out to your audience and promote sharing and engagement.
Step 10: Analyze Your Map’s Performance
Finally, it’s important to analyze how well your map is performing. Use analytics tools to track metrics like user engagement, pageviews, and bounce rates to gain insight into how your map is being used and to guide future improvements.
3. Platforms for Creating Interactive Maps
Creating an interactive map may seem like a daunting task, especially if you don’t have any coding skills. Fortunately, there are several platforms that you can choose from, each with its own set of features and user interface. In this section, we’ll discuss some of the most popular platforms for creating interactive maps.
1. Google Maps Platform
Google Maps Platform is undoubtedly one of the most used mapping tools for creating interactive maps. It offers a wide range of features, from the basic ones like location markers, lines, and shapes to advanced ones such as geocoding services, custom styling, and real-time traffic updates. You can integrate Google Maps Platform with other Google services like Google Sheets, Google Drive, and Google Firebase to add more functionality to your maps.
2. Leaflet
Leaflet is an open-source JavaScript library that allows you to create mobile-friendly, interactive maps easily. It is lightweight and customizable, making it a popular choice for developers who want to build custom maps from scratch. Leaflet supports a wide range of basemaps, including OpenStreetMap, Google Maps, and Bing Maps. It also has a vast collection of plugins that enable you to add various features to your maps, such as markers, pop-ups, and heatmaps.
3. Mapbox
Mapbox is a mapping platform that provides tools for designing custom maps, adding location data, and building custom applications. It offers a wide range of customization options, including custom styles, markers, and map projections. Mapbox also provides a JavaScript API that allows you to integrate maps into your web applications easily. The platform has a free plan that allows you to create up to 50,000 map views per month.
4. CARTO
CARTO is a cloud-based mapping platform that enables you to create location-based visualizations and analysis. It has a user-friendly interface that requires no coding skills to use. CARTO offers various features like real-time data visualization, heat maps, and interactive widgets. CARTO supports a wide range of data formats, including spreadsheets, databases, and geospatial files.
5. ArcGIS Online
ArcGIS Online is a cloud-based mapping platform that provides mapping, analysis, and sharing capabilities. It enables you to create custom maps, perform spatial analysis, and share your maps with others. ArcGIS Online offers a wide range of tools, including mapping templates, basemaps, and data layers. It also allows you to create custom applications using the ArcGIS API for JavaScript.
Feature | Google Maps Platform | Leaflet | Mapbox | CARTO | ArcGIS Online |
---|---|---|---|---|---|
Custom styling | ✅ | ✅ | ✅ | ✅ | ✅ |
Real-time updates | ✅ | ❌ | ✅ | ✅ | ✅ |
Integration with other services | ✅ | ❌ | ✅ | ✅ | ✅ |
No coding required | ❌ | ✅ | ❌ | ✅ | ✅ |
Cost | Free for non-commercial use | Free and open-source | Free up to 50,000 map views per month | Free for personal use; paid plans for businesses | Free up to 2,500 map views per month; paid plans for more views and features |
In conclusion, creating an interactive map is now more accessible than ever, thanks to the various platforms available. Each platform has its unique features and pricing structure, so it’s essential to identify your requirements before choosing the right one. With the right tool in hand, you can build interactive maps that showcase your data and engage your audience.
Wrapping It Up
We hope this guide has helped you understand how to make an interactive map. Remember, the key to a successful map is to keep it simple, informative, and visually appealing. Don’t be afraid to experiment with different tools and features to make your map stand out. Thanks for reading, and we hope you come back to explore new topics with us in the future. Until next time, happy mapping!
Tinggalkan Balasan